**14:05** — Autocomplete latency on Quillet search hit 900ms p95. Root cause: the Fernwood index shard rebalance left hot segments unmerged overnight. Merge forced manually at 14:20; latency recovered by 14:31. Action item: add merge-lag alerting before next rebalance window. The offending build is identified by the trace below.

session token of kafof-kafop = htk31_c3becf8b8eac3ed970037fba36e258e

## Changelog — Font vendoring defaults changed

As of this release, the Bracken UI build no longer fetches third-party fonts at build time. All typefaces used by the Lanternwell suite are now vendored into the repo under a dedicated assets directory, and the fetch step is skipped by default. If you're onboarding, nothing to install — the fonts travel with the checkout. The build flags controlling this behavior are listed below.

settings of hadup-yafog:
LAMAEL_PIN=3761
LAMAEL_TENANT=istmir
LAMAEL_METRICS_HOST=metrics.lamael.plorvasys.test
LAMAEL_SEAL=seal_8ea68500
LAMAEL_STANDBY_TEAM=fraok

Ticket: Config drift in Vaultspin rotation utility. Support reports rotations firing at odd intervals on two hosts. Running config no longer matches the committed baseline — someone hot-patched the schedule last month and never merged it. Need reconciliation before next rotation window. For triage, the current on-host values are pasted below.

settings of tagef-bawif:
DRUIX_HOST=druix.zemvarlabs.internal
DRUIX_PORT=8000

### Deploy Step 4: Configure FareForge

Before promoting the FareForge rules engine to production, update the app server's env file. Set `FAREFORGE_RULESET=prod-2024q4` and `FAREFORGE_CURRENCY_SOURCE=internal` so fee calculations use the signed ruleset bundle. Bundle verification requires a key held in the release vault. Directly beneath the two lines above, add the line that sets the ruleset verification secret.

sealed setting: LEDGER_TOKEN29=130a4f7ada97c8be1e00128e577ab